Jackson Morgan Brown Sugar & Cinnamon Southern Cream 750ML is a Tennessee whiskey-based cream liqueur bottled at 15% ABV (30 proof) in a 750ml bottle. A Silver Medal winner at the 2016 San Francisco World Spirits Competition, this expression stands out for its use of locally sourced Tennessee whiskey and real dairy cream as the foundation for its brown sugar and cinnamon profile.
Quick Facts: ABV: 15% (30 Proof) | Origin: Fayetteville, Tennessee, USA | Style: Flavored Cream Liqueur | Brand: Jackson Morgan Southern Cream
Production & Heritage
Jackson Morgan Southern Cream was created by Mike Wetherington and Ray Steelman in Fayetteville, Tennessee, with the goal of bringing playful Southern character to the cream liqueur category. The base begins with a blend of Tennessee whiskey and neutral grain spirits, which is then infused with natural brown sugar and cinnamon flavoring before being married with real dairy cream. This approach differentiates it from many competitors that rely on rum or vodka bases, giving the final product a distinctly Southern whiskey backbone beneath the sweetness.
Tasting Notes
Aroma: Warm cinnamon greets the nose first, followed by rich brown sugar sweetness and a subtle undercurrent of whiskey grain. The dairy cream rounds the aromatics into something inviting and dessert-like.
Taste: The entry is immediately creamy, with brown sugar dominating the front palate before cinnamon spice builds through the mid-palate. The Tennessee whiskey base provides just enough structure to keep the sweetness grounded, creating a layered interplay between sugar, spice, and smooth dairy richness.
Finish: Medium in length with lingering cinnamon warmth and a trailing sweetness reminiscent of brown sugar butter. The cream softens the close, leaving a velvety texture on the palate.

How does Jackson Morgan Brown Sugar & Cinnamon compare to RumChata? RumChata uses a Caribbean rum base with horchata-inspired vanilla and cinnamon flavors, while Jackson Morgan relies on a Tennessee whiskey foundation with a more pronounced brown sugar sweetness and bolder cinnamon character. The whiskey base gives Jackson Morgan a slightly warmer, more robust backbone compared to RumChata's lighter, vanilla-forward profile.
